For those who, like me, were a bit bemused - Smeeton Westerby is in Leicestershire ;D

The GenUKI page (http://www.genuki.org.uk/big/eng/LEI/SmeetonWesterby) states that the parish register dates from 1852.
For earlier times, the parish was Kibworth Beauchamp.

Parish records will almost certainly be held at Leicestershire Archives.

Very few abodes are given in the Kibworth registers for baptisms and burials before 1813, after which there are numerous for Smeeton. Also few abodes for marriages prior to 1837.

Smeeton Westerby baptisms, weddings and funerals were held at Kibworth, and the original PRs note whether the person was from SW, KH or KB - (ie Smeeton Westerby, Kibworth Harcourt or K Beauchamp) - I forget how long back these abodes were noted, but I'm sure it precedes 1800 as I've had cause to look back well into the 1700s in these registers and seen it then.
